Design-Build Process

Six steps from first call to final walkthrough.

Most Maryland remodels split between three companies: a designer, a contractor, and someone to coordinate. We handle all three. One contract. One signature on the warranty.

  1. 01

    Free in-home consultation

    60–90 minutes. No fee. No pressure.

    We come to you, walk the space, listen to how you live, and rough-bracket the scope. By the end of the visit you know roughly what your project will cost and how long it will take.

  2. 02

    Design + material selection

    3D renderings, samples in-hand, finish board.

    You see the bathroom or kitchen rendered in 3D before a single tile is ordered. We bring physical samples to your home: tile, paint chips, cabinet doors, hardware, fixtures. Every choice on the table — yours or ours.

  3. 03

    Fixed-price agreement

    Line-item itemization. Real schedule. Signed.

    You get a single fixed-price contract. Every line item, every fixture, every brand spelled out. Payment schedule tied to milestones, not arbitrary dates. Change-order policy in writing.

  4. 04

    Permits + lead times

    We file with your county. Materials ordered.

    We pull every permit your project requires (Montgomery, Howard, Anne Arundel, Baltimore County, Frederick, Prince George's — same week filing). Cabinets, tile, fixtures all ordered before demo so the home is offline less time.

  5. 05

    Build

    One foreman. Daily updates. Floor protection.

    One foreman is on site every day, your single point of contact. ZipWall containment, RamBoard floor protection, end-of-day clean-up. Photo updates each evening so you know exactly where we are.

  6. 06

    Quality walk + 5-year warranty

    Punch list. Inspection. Signed warranty.

    You walk every surface with us. Anything you flag, we fix before final invoice. County inspection passes. Signed 5-year workmanship warranty plus all manufacturer warranties handed over in a project binder.
